What is a Bariatric Wheelchair?
Bariatric wheelchairs are designed specifically for individuals who are obese or obese. They typically feature:
Wider Seats: To supply additional space and comfort.Stronger Frames: Made of strengthened products to support higher weight limits, ranging from 300 to 1,000 pounds or more.Boosted Stability: To make sure safety and avoid tipping.Table 1: Differences Between Standard and Bariatric WheelchairsFeatureStandard WheelchairBariatric WheelchairWeight CapacityAs much as 250-300 lbs300 lbs to 1,000 lbs or moreSeat Width16-20 inches20-28 inches or moreFrame MaterialAluminum or steelEnhanced steel or durable aluminumWheel SizeStandard (normally 24 inches)Larger wheels for stabilityArmrest WidthRequirement widthBroader, frequently adjustableAdvantages of Bariatric Wheelchairs
Bariatric wheelchairs use many advantages beyond just size. Here are some crucial benefits:
Comfort: The larger and cushioned seats promote comfort, especially for prolonged durations of usage.
Toughness: Designed to withstand higher weight and usage, these wheelchairs frequently feature robust guarantees, making sure durability.
Boosted Mobility: With features such as larger wheels and enhanced maneuverability, users can navigate various terrains more quickly.
Security Features: Many designs include anti-tippers, safety belt, and leg supports, offering additional security.
Modification Options: Many bariatric wheelchairs can be personalized to satisfy individual requirements, consisting of adjustable armrests, footrests, and seat heights.

When choosing a bariatric wheelchair, there are numerous important factors to think about:
Weight and Size: Ensure the wheelchair can comfortably support the user's weight and body size. Speak with the specifications to discover the appropriate weight capacity and seat width.
Seating Comfort: Evaluate the cushioning and materials used in the seat. Comfort is essential for long-lasting usage.
Maneuverability: Test the wheelchair for smooth operation, especially if the user will be navigating tight spaces or uneven surfaces.
Customization: Look for models that provide adjustable features to accommodate specific requirements. This might consist of adjustable footrests, armrests, and back-rests.
Mobility: If mobility is a concern, think about choices that are lightweight or foldable.
Devices: Evaluate the accessibility of devices such as safety belt, additional cushions, and storage bags, which can boost the wheelchair's functionality.
FAQs About Bariatric Wheelchairs
1. What is the weight limit for bariatric wheelchairs?Bariatric wheelchairs can support weights ranging from 300 pounds to over 1,000 pounds, depending on the model.
2. Are bariatric wheelchairs more pricey than basic wheelchairs?Yes, due to the specialized materials and construction needed, bariatric wheelchairs usually have a greater price point than basic wheelchairs.
3. Can I use a bariatric wheelchair for outside activities?Lots of bariatric wheelchairs are developed for both indoor and outside usage, especially those with larger wheels and resilient frames.
4. How do I keep a bariatric wheelchair?Regular upkeep includes examining tire pressure, cleaning up the frame, oiling moving parts, and inspecting brakes and other safety functions.
5. Are there bariatric wheelchairs that fold for simple storage?Yes, numerous bariatric wheelchairs provide a folding design, making them convenient for storage and transport.
